¿Cómo arreglar la react-fecha-fecha-picker en iOS?

¿Quién me puede explicar esto? Estoy usando el adaptador de fecha de react, pero cuando ejecuto la aplicación con diferentes versiones de dispositivos iOS, muestran un estilo de fecha diferente. Muchas gracias.

enter image description here

Pregunta hecha hace 3 años, 4 meses, 27 días - Por devdynamox


3 Respuestas:

  • Reactúa los componentes nativos UI basados en una plataforma de destino y pueden ser diferentes en diferentes plataformas o diferentes versiones de plataforma. Simplemente decir React Native le proporciona un puente para administrar un actual control nativo de la UI.

    iOS tiene UIDatePicker control nativo que implementa la entrada de valores de fecha y hora y se ha cambiado varias veces (https://www.andyibanez.com/posts/new-uidatepicker-ios14/). Así que si desea tener la misma apariencia del selector de fecha debe crear su propio componente RN puro o utilizar cualquier fuente abierta.

    Respondida el Dec 18, 2020 a las 10:09 - por codecrusader

    Votos positivos: 0 | Votos negativos: 0

  • Para lograr que el estilo de la fecha seleccionada se vea consistente en diferentes versiones de dispositivos iOS al utilizar react-datepicker, puedes intentar lo siguiente:

    • Asegúrate de tener la última versión de react-datepicker instalada.
    • Agrega los estilos necesarios en tu archivo CSS para personalizar el aspecto del componente.
    • Utiliza las propiedades proporcionadas por react-datepicker para ajustar el estilo, como `className`, `calendarClassName`, `dayClassName`, entre otras.
    • Si necesitas un estilo específico para dispositivos iOS, considera utilizar media queries en tu archivo CSS para adaptar el diseño según el dispositivo.
    • Prueba el componente en diferentes versiones de dispositivos iOS y realiza ajustes según sea necesario para lograr la consistencia en el estilo de la fecha seleccionada.

    Si después de seguir estos pasos todavía experimentas problemas con el estilo de fecha en dispositivos iOS, considera buscar en la documentación oficial de react-datepicker o en la comunidad de desarrolladores de React para obtener más consejos específicos para este problema.

    Respondida el Dec 19, 2020 a las 10:08 - por Gpt

    Votos positivos: 0 | Votos negativos: 0

  • Posibles causas y soluciones para el problema de estilo de React Date Picker en iOS:

    Versiones de iOS: Asegúrate de usar la última versión de iOS, ya que las versiones anteriores pueden tener problemas de estilo con React Date Picker. Paquete de fecha adaptable: Verifica que estás usando la última versión del paquete react-date-adapter. También asegúrate de usar el adaptador correcto para tu biblioteca de fechas (por ejemplo, @date-io/date-fns para Date-fns). Estilo personalizado: Si has aplicado estilos personalizados al Date Picker, asegúrate de que sean compatibles con varias versiones de iOS. Considera usar bibliotecas de estilo como styled-components o emotion para garantizar la coherencia. Tema del sistema: Verifica si el tema del sistema del dispositivo iOS está causando el problema. Intenta cambiar el tema del sistema y observa si el estilo del Date Picker cambia. Versión del navegador: Si estás probando la aplicación en un navegador en iOS, asegúrate de usar la última versión del navegador. Los navegadores obsoletos pueden tener problemas de estilo. Dependencias: Asegúrate de que todas las dependencias de tu aplicación estén actualizadas. Pueden surgir problemas de estilo debido a incompatibilidades entre diferentes versiones de dependencias. Modo oscuro: Comprueba si el problema ocurre solo en modo oscuro. Si es así, asegúrate de proporcionar estilos específicos para el modo oscuro en tu aplicación.

    Pasos adicionales de solución de problemas:

    Usa las herramientas de depuración de React para inspeccionar los componentes y verificar el estilo aplicado. Crea una aplicación de prueba simple que contenga solo el Date Picker para aislar el problema. Compara el código de tu aplicación con ejemplos de trabajo para ver si hay diferencias. * Publica un problema en el repositorio de GitHub de React Date Picker si no puedes resolver el problema.

    Respondida el Dec 19, 2020 a las 10:17 - por Gemini

    Votos positivos: 0 | Votos negativos: 0